Trae初体验,字节也出AI IDE了,用它写个掘金

1,564 阅读2分钟

作为一名程序员,本着能摸鱼绝不干活的基本思想.在AI出来后更是踊跃使用,继续我的摸鱼事业.

安装

从国外的github copilot 到国内通义灵码 MarsCode cursor等工具,确实是提高了我的摸鱼效率.最近看到字节的Trae,是国内唯一一个AI+IDE的产品,那必须来试一试了.

首先是下载IDE了,下载链接丢这里: www.trae.ai/?utm_source… 不过目前只有mac版,window在准备中.

下载安装好之后,首先先测试一下它对项目工程化能否看到:

image.png 简单测试下,右下角可以切换对应的AI 默认支持GPT-4o和 Claude-3.5-Sonnet两个模型.chat默认会识别你打开的文件.

使用

接下来就简单用它来改改我的业务吧. 下图可以看到,简单的业务识别修改还是很精准的,但是这里我点击应用时,提示当前文件过大,暂时不支持Apply.这里还是需要优化优化的.还好也提供了复制和插入光标功能.

image.png

后面再来个需求吧,我直接将产品想要添加的改动描述发给Trae,简单的业务是没有问题

image.png

这里还有个Builder模式

我把掘金首页截图下来了,让它根据这个图片开发一个掘金 一步一步创建项目,执行命令需要人工确认

image.png

image.png

image.png

image.png

image.png

image.png

到这里创建好react的框架了,但是没有开发掘金的页面功能,我提醒一下它

image.png

这里遇到个问题,创建好项目后,运行浏览器报错了,它识别不到,只能我手动复制错误给它,这个IDE集成了内部浏览器,监听到报错应该也是能做到的吧,希望能够优化. 接下来项目算是创建好了,正常预览了

image.png

但还是没有写我的掘金页面,我再提示一下

image.png 结果告诉我它已经实现了.看了偷懒了呀

简单体验下来,chat模式还是采用了传统的对话模式交互,比较好的点是能看到当前模块的代码,进行综合考虑生成结果,比插件这种好.还有一个Builder模式还在测试中,这个比cursor好,可以上传图片.不过如果能出composer模式真的就太好了,笔记复制粘贴也是需要时间的,后面慢慢优化,取长补短,还是不错的